Almendrado Tequila Recipe

Inspired by Elote Cafe
Time168h
Serves8

Almond infused sweet Tequila

Method

Directions

  1. 1

    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read almonds on a baking sheet and toast for 8–10 minutes, until golden and fragrant. Remove from oven and let cool completely.

  2. 2

    In a clean 1-liter glass jar, combine the blanco tequila, toasted almonds, and vanilla extract. Seal the jar and shake to distribute the flavors. Store in a cool, dark place.

  3. 3

    Allow the tequila almond infusion to steep for 5–7 days, shaking the jar once daily to help release the almond aroma.

  4. 4

    Make a simple syrup by combining sugar and water in a small saucepan. Bring to a gentle simmer over medium heat, stirring until the sugar fully dissolves. Remove from heat and cool completely.

  5. 5

    After the infusion period, strain the tequila mixture through a fine-mesh sieve or cheesecloth to remove almond solids. Return the clear infusion to a clean container.

  6. 6

    Add cooled simple syrup to the strained tequila to sweeten. Start with a 1:1 ratio of infusion to syrup and adjust to taste. Stir well and taste; add more syrup in 1–2 tablespoon increments if you prefer sweeter tequila.

  7. 7

    Bottle the finished Almendrado Tequila in a clean bottle. Chill before serving. This almond-infused tequila can be enjoyed neat, on the rocks, or used as a dessert cocktail base.
